  • Comments Thread For: Joshua-Klitschko II - Hearn Says Nigeria a Frontrunner To Host

    ANTHONY Joshua's lucrative rematch with Wladimir Klitschko could be hosted in very unexpected location if promoter Eddie Hearn is to be believed. Hearn, 38, all but confirmed AJ would step back into the ring with Dr Steelhammer later this year in an interview with Boxing News earlier this week. And with the eyes of the world now watching Joshua's every move after unifying the WBA, IBO and IBF belts with victory over Klitschko, fans have been clamouring for more details about the champ's next fight.
